I have an entry in the Family Tree for a David Rollo, Shipmaster, born at Balmerino, Fife on 23 Sep 1810 who was "Drowned - in Berwick Bay" on 3 Mar 1854. The information comes from the Fife Family History Society pre-1855 Death Index and has been extracted from the Mitchell Monumental Inscriptions - presumably taken from a (commemorative) family gravestone inscription.
There's no mention of the name of any vessel and I can't find anythng so far in the local papers from the time ... although I will keep looking!
Following a post in the "Common Room", and the responses I received there, it appears that the"Berwick Bay" mentioned is the one off the Scottish coast? Threre is another in Louisiana, USA!
